Property Crime in Gatesville, TX

Our analysis gives Gatesville a property crime grade of: D. Gatesville is in the 79th percentile of safety, meaning 79% of cities in Texas are safer and 21% are more dangerous. Please visit our Gatesville crime map for details on how this is calculated and what it means.

Property crime is highest in the northern part of Gatesville, with your chances of being a victim of 1 in 18. Compare this to the southwestern part of the city, where crime is lower, and your chances of being a victim are 1 in 127.
